Associate
I'd like to address a problem related to poor gaming performance ppl sometimes encounter when playing games with their new AMD dual core set-up.
This issue is almost always caused by an incorrectly edited AMD X2 hotfix registry and/or not correctly installing the AMD X2 drivers.
I feel now that these AMD X2 processors are coming down in price there maybe more and more people asking why there system struggles to play games smoothly with there new dc processor. We will not see this problem resolved until MS releases SP3. That means we will have to continue using this hotfix and separate X2 drivers until the new service pack is released, so why not make this a sticky and remove it when SP3 is released??
Note: It is also a common misnomer that these AMD drivers are used for Cool'n'Quiet only, this is not true.
OK, this is the correct method of installation for the HF and X2 drivers outlined by MS and AMD.
- It would be a good Idea to back up your registry before you continue.
1 - Install the amd drivers, download it from here
2 - read this website and download the hotfix....READ Here ........Download here
3 - Edit your registry to enable the HOTFIX, follow these steps:
1. Click Start, click Run, type regedit in the Open box, and then click OK.
2. Right-click H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Contro l\Session Manager, point to New, and then click Key.
3. Type Throttle for the new key name.
4. Right-click Throttle, point to New, and then click DWORD Value.
5. Type PerfEnablePackageIdle for the value name.
6. Right-click PerfEnablePackageIdle, and then click Modify.
7. In the Edit DWORD Value box, type 1. In the Value data box, make sure that Hexadecimal is selected, and then click OK.
8. Quit Registry Editor.
4 - Make sure your BOOT.ini has this command in it, /usepmtimer to check, right click on My Computer go to properties, click on the ADVANCE tab, then under startup and recovery click on settings, then click on EDIT....make sure your boot.ini looks like this
[boot loader]
timeout=30
default=multi(0)disk(0)rdisk(0)partition(1)\WINDOW S
[operating systems]
mult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/noexecute=optin /fastdetect /usepmtimer
Finally your done!
How to remove the Hotfix and x2 drivers.
1 - Uninstall the Hotfix, go into ad/remove programs, click on show updates and remove update numbered KB896256
2 - Reverse the registry entry.
3 - Uninstall the AMD drivers.
4 - Go into your boot.ini and remove /usepmtimer, and your done.
The Affinity solution
If you continue to have game performance issues I recommend trying out the common affinity solution. It mostly relates to a combination of Cool'n'Quiet or games that have to have their affinity set to use one processor, but you may still have issues with CnQ disabled.
To set a program's affinity to a particular core:
1) Run the game you wish to play; then minimize the window
2) Press Ctrl+Alt+Del to access Windows Task Manager
3) Under the 'Applications' tab, Right Click the game's icon and select 'Go To
Process'
Doing so will take you to the 'Processes' tab.
4) You will notice that the game's process has been highlighted for you. Right
Click the process and select 'Set Affinity'
5) Assign the game's affinity to CPU0 as this is the default CPU core.
Doing so will allow windows to prioritise the game to a single core instead of
trying to distribute the load across both cores.
Hopefully this will help a lot of people struggling with their x2 systems.
Regards
This issue is almost always caused by an incorrectly edited AMD X2 hotfix registry and/or not correctly installing the AMD X2 drivers.
I feel now that these AMD X2 processors are coming down in price there maybe more and more people asking why there system struggles to play games smoothly with there new dc processor. We will not see this problem resolved until MS releases SP3. That means we will have to continue using this hotfix and separate X2 drivers until the new service pack is released, so why not make this a sticky and remove it when SP3 is released??
Note: It is also a common misnomer that these AMD drivers are used for Cool'n'Quiet only, this is not true.
OK, this is the correct method of installation for the HF and X2 drivers outlined by MS and AMD.
- It would be a good Idea to back up your registry before you continue.
1 - Install the amd drivers, download it from here
2 - read this website and download the hotfix....READ Here ........Download here
3 - Edit your registry to enable the HOTFIX, follow these steps:
1. Click Start, click Run, type regedit in the Open box, and then click OK.
2. Right-click H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Contro l\Session Manager, point to New, and then click Key.
3. Type Throttle for the new key name.
4. Right-click Throttle, point to New, and then click DWORD Value.
5. Type PerfEnablePackageIdle for the value name.
6. Right-click PerfEnablePackageIdle, and then click Modify.
7. In the Edit DWORD Value box, type 1. In the Value data box, make sure that Hexadecimal is selected, and then click OK.
8. Quit Registry Editor.
4 - Make sure your BOOT.ini has this command in it, /usepmtimer to check, right click on My Computer go to properties, click on the ADVANCE tab, then under startup and recovery click on settings, then click on EDIT....make sure your boot.ini looks like this
[boot loader]
timeout=30
default=multi(0)disk(0)rdisk(0)partition(1)\WINDOW S
[operating systems]
mult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/noexecute=optin /fastdetect /usepmtimer
Finally your done!
How to remove the Hotfix and x2 drivers.
1 - Uninstall the Hotfix, go into ad/remove programs, click on show updates and remove update numbered KB896256
2 - Reverse the registry entry.
3 - Uninstall the AMD drivers.
4 - Go into your boot.ini and remove /usepmtimer, and your done.
The Affinity solution
If you continue to have game performance issues I recommend trying out the common affinity solution. It mostly relates to a combination of Cool'n'Quiet or games that have to have their affinity set to use one processor, but you may still have issues with CnQ disabled.
To set a program's affinity to a particular core:
1) Run the game you wish to play; then minimize the window
2) Press Ctrl+Alt+Del to access Windows Task Manager
3) Under the 'Applications' tab, Right Click the game's icon and select 'Go To
Process'
Doing so will take you to the 'Processes' tab.
4) You will notice that the game's process has been highlighted for you. Right
Click the process and select 'Set Affinity'
5) Assign the game's affinity to CPU0 as this is the default CPU core.
Doing so will allow windows to prioritise the game to a single core instead of
trying to distribute the load across both cores.
Hopefully this will help a lot of people struggling with their x2 systems.
Regards